Latest Patents

Harada holds a patent for an internal heat exchanger and refrigeration cycle apparatus. This invention features a double pipe that forms an inner flow path for low-pressure side refrigerant and an outer flow path for high-pressure side refrigerant. The design includes connectors for an expansion valve and counter-expansion valve, ensuring effective refrigerant flow while preventing leakage. The outer diameter of the outer pipe is limited to 30 millimeters or less, and the ratio of the difference between the inner and outer diameters is maintained at 25% or less. This innovative design enhances the efficiency of refrigeration systems.
